Brief Biography

Ranked by Forbes as one of the "Top 5" most respected coaches, Richard Leider is a best-selling author with thirty years experience in coaching people to live and work on purpose. As founder and Chairman of The Inventure Group, he is an internationally recognized speaker who works with many leading organizations such as 3M, Boeing, American Express, Pfizer and the Mayo Clinic. As a leader in executive development, Richard has taught over 100,000 executives from 50 corporations worldwide.

He is the author of seven books, including three best-sellers, and his work has been translated in 17 languages. Repacking Your Bags and The Power of Purpose are considered classics in the personal development field. His newest book, Claiming Your Place At the Fire, has been touted as "the defining" book on the new retirement. As a commentator on life transitions, Richard has been published in the Wall Street Journal, The New York Times and USA Today, and has appeared as a guest on television and public radio.

 A Nationally Certified Master Career Counselor, Richard also holds a Master’s Degree in Counseling and is a Senior Fellow at the University of Minnesota’s Center for Spirituality & Healing. He consistently receives the highest marks as an educator in the Global Learning Resource Network of Duke Corporate Education and is an adjunct faculty member at the University of Minnesota Carlson School's Executive Development Center.

 Along with his professional pursuits, Richard has led annual Inventure Expedition walking safaris in East Africa for over 20 years.

 His work received recognition from the Bush Foundation, from which he was awarded a Bush Fellowship to study "purposeful aging." Believing passionately that each of us is born with a purpose, he is dedicated to coaching people to discover their own power of purpose.
